2007 Jeep Wrangler vs. 2005 Saab 9-2x

To start off, 2007 Jeep Wrangler is newer by 2 year(s). Which means there will be less support and parts availability for 2005 Saab 9-2x. In addition, the cost of maintenance, including insurance, on 2005 Saab 9-2x would be higher. At 3,778 cc (6 cylinders), 2007 Jeep Wrangler is equipped with a bigger engine. In terms of performance, 2005 Saab 9-2x (227 HP @ 4000 RPM) has 25 more horse power than 2007 Jeep Wrangler. (202 HP @ 5200 RPM) In normal driving conditions, 2005 Saab 9-2x should accelerate faster than 2007 Jeep Wrangler.

Both vehicles are four wheel drive (4WD) - it offers better handling, traction, and control in all driving conditions compared with front wheel drive or rear wheel drive vehicles. With that said, do keep in mind that many other factors such as speed and the wear on your tires can also have significant impact on traction and control. Let's talk about torque, 2007 Jeep Wrangler (321 Nm) has 27 more torque (in Nm) than 2005 Saab 9-2x. (294 Nm). This means 2007 Jeep Wrangler will have an easier job in driving up hills or pulling heavy equipment than 2005 Saab 9-2x.

Compare all specifications:

2007 Jeep Wrangler 2005 Saab 9-2x
Make Jeep Saab
Model Wrangler 9-2x
Year Released 2007 2005
Body Type SUV Station Wagon
Engine Position Front Front
Engine Size 3778 cc 1997 cc
Engine Type V boxer
Valves per Cylinder 2 valves 4 valves
Horse Power 202 HP 227 HP
Engine RPM 5200 RPM 4000 RPM
Torque 321 Nm 294 Nm
Engine Compression Ratio 9.0:1 8.0:1
Drive Type 4WD 4WD
Number of Seats 4 seats 5 seats
Vehicle Length 3890 mm 4470 mm
Vehicle Width 1880 mm 1700 mm
Vehicle Height 1810 mm 1470 mm
Wheelbase Size 2430 mm 2530 mm
Fuel Consumption Highway 12.4 L/100km 9.1 L/100km
Fuel Consumption City 13.8 L/100km 11.8 L/100km
Fuel Consumption Overall 13.1 L/100km 10.7 L/100km
Fuel Tank Capacity 70 L 60 L
